In recent years, the field of robotics has seen a surge in investment interest from various sectors. From venture capitalists to tech companies to governments, the push to develop and integrate robotics technology into our daily lives seems to be at an all-time high. However, with all the hype and buzz surrounding robotics investments, it is essential to separate the truth from the sensationalized news headlines. One common misconception that often leads to inflated expectations is the belief that robotics technology is already at a stage where it can seamlessly replace human labor across all industries. While it is true that advancements in robotics have enabled automation in many sectors, the technology is still far from being able to replicate the cognitive abilities and nuanced decision-making capabilities of a human worker. As such, investors should approach robotics investments with a realistic perspective on the current limitations of the technology. Another aspect to consider when evaluating robotics investments is the regulatory landscape. Robotics technology comes with its own set of ethical and legal challenges, such as concerns surrounding data privacy, job displacement, and liability in the case of accidents involving autonomous robots. Investors should be mindful of the potential regulatory hurdles that could affect the viability and scalability of robotics solutions in the market. Furthermore, it is crucial for investors to conduct thorough due diligence on the robotics companies they are considering investing in. This includes assessing the team's expertise, the scalability of the technology, the market demand for the product or service, and the company's competitive positioning within the industry. By taking a comprehensive approach to due diligence, investors can mitigate risks and make more informed decisions when it comes to robotics investments. Despite the challenges and uncertainties surrounding robotics investments, there is no denying the potential of this technology to revolutionize various industries and improve efficiency and productivity. By staying informed and approaching investments with a critical eye, investors can navigate the complex landscape of robotics investments and contribute to the growth and development of this exciting field.
